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3679696 563 1920
95706 370044
95706 370044
766460 55 83570
All about undefined
Interested in learning more?
95706 370044
766460 55 83570
See more
426 17400448398 11496
65536645 2154 6790556
See more
5500448 4817852 1700302104
561 68 9000029929 72969336235 583518604
See more